2010 LS460. Newbie question.
Hello all. I just got my car about 1 month ago. Being MB guy for 10 previous years I got some habits, that I'm missing in LS. One of them is memory seat recall feature. It looks like the only way to recall memory position is when a car is not moving and in P or N position. I actually have 2 different settings for city and highway and would like to switch it while the car is moving. Does anybody know how can I bypass this lock ?

Techstream is a computer system used by Lexus and Toyota to diagnose and customize Toyota, Scion and Lexus vehicles. Carista is a program you can install in your smartphone that does myuch the same thing (ie:, change many features in your vehicle, such as DRL's, seatbelt buzzers, how long your lights stay on after turniong the vehicle off etc).
